What the job involves:

  • Key member of the Maintenance team, driving delivery of all maintenance instructions.
  • Provide frontline support to our clients, tenants and third party contractors.
  • Support colleagues within the company, ensuring all related maintenance is completed on time and on budget.
  • Manage and deliver on day-to-day maintenance requests across the full region portfolio.
  • Deliver high standards of customer service at all times, ensuring a proactive approach to all incoming queries.
  • Understand and deliver maintenance projects in line with client requests, whilst guiding on legislation and repairing standards.
  • Manage and respond to day-to-day email and telephone requests from Landlords, Tenants and Contractors.
  • Ensure all maintenance requests are logged and noted accurately, utilizing internal software platforms.
  • Flag and deal with any conflicts correctly.
  • Take responsibility for any urgent and/or outstanding maintenance tickets and ensure they are resolved in a timely manner.
  • Work alongside our Compliance team to ensure safety certification is up to date and logged correctly.
  • Collaborate with your Team Manager and Associate Manager to ensure department delivers on KPIs and budgets.
